Output 6611087bc288bae7368fa5cf093276a40f110724bb95a6b806055d7966b78b86:3

value
624097005
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db847ced62dc4eac2fcdeeca61f8a0a669f57d4c OP_EQUAL
address
3MhicyurQZHJhwDEMFcBHZVEDKWuHxjApX
transaction
6611087bc288bae7368fa5cf093276a40f110724bb95a6b806055d7966b78b86
spent
true